在现代计算机技术的推动下,Data Engineering Infrastructure(简称DEI)的使用越来越普遍。DEI系统在多个领域,如大数据处理、智能分析和云计算中扮演着重要角色。调试和优化DEI系统不仅可以提高效率,还能减少错误频率。然而,许多用户在调试DEI时可能面临不同程度的困难,本文将详细为您介绍如何高效调试电脑DEI系统。

理解DEI系统的基础

调试之前,首先需要对DEI系统的基本架构有清晰的理解。一个典型的DEI体系结构包含以下几个模块:

  • 数据采集:收集外部数据。
  • 数据预处理:清洗和转换数据。
  • 数据存储:将数据存储在不同的数据库中。
  • 数据分析:使用算法对数据进行处理。
  • 结果展示:通过各种可视化手段展现分析结果。

调试的常见问题

在调试DEI系统时,用户常常会遇到以下几种问题:

  • 数据无法采集:检查数据源配置、网络连接和权限设置。
  • 数据处理缓慢:分析数据预处理的效率,并检查是否使用了合适的算法。
  • 数据存储错误:验证数据库连接、表结构及写入权限。
  • 分析算法错误:确保算法正确实现,并对输入数据进行合理验证。
  • 可视化展示不全:检查图表库和可视化工具的兼容性。

调试步骤

以下是调试DEI系统的一些步骤,帮助您逐步排查并解决问题:

  1. 步骤一:查看日志文件 - 系统日志是调试的第一步,通过分析日志中的错误信息,能够迅速定位问题所在。
  2. 步骤二:逐模块排查 - 分别对各个模块进行测试,逐步优化和调整,确保每个模块都能正常工作。
  3. 步骤三:检查配置文件 - 常常出现问题的原因是配置错误,仔细检查所有相关的配置文件设置。
  4. 步骤四:进行单元测试 - 为每个功能模块编写单元测试,确保各个模块独立性及正确性。
  5. 步骤五:优化算法 - 当识别出处理缓慢的问题时,可以考虑用更有效的算法或方法进行替换。
  6. 步骤六:进行负载测试 - 对系统进行压力测试,以确保在高并发情况下的稳定性。

工具推荐

在调试DEI系统时,适当的调试工具可以大大提高效率。以下是一些常用的调试工具:

  • Log查看工具(如Logstash):帮助用户分析和可视化日志。
  • 性能分析工具(如JProfiler):用于分析Java应用的性能瓶颈。
  • 测试框架(如JUnit、pytest):帮助开发者进行单元测试。
  • 数据库监控工具(如Prometheus):实时监控数据库的性能与健康状态。
  • 可视化工具(如Tableau、Power BI):用于数据可视化和结果展示。

如何持续优化

调试不是一次性的工作,而是一个持续的过程。为了保持系统的最佳性能,建议定期进行如下活动:

  • 定期审查代码:保持代码的整洁和高效,定期进行代码审查以发现潜在漏洞。
  • 进行性能基准测试:定期与历史数据对比,追踪性能变化。
  • 收集用户反馈:根据使用者的反馈优化系统。
  • 保持更新:定期更新系统组件,保持兼容性和安全性。

总结

调试电脑DEI系统虽然具有挑战性,但通过系统化的方法和实践,可以有效减少调试时间,提高系统的可靠性。希望本文为您在调试DEI系统时提供了一些实用的策略和工具。

感谢您阅读完这篇文章!希望通过本文的指导,您在调试DEI系统时能够事半功倍。